Mac Robertson Postgraduate Travel Scholarship in UK

The University of Strathclyde and the University of
Glasgow are jointly offering Mac Robertson Scholarship for UK/EU and
overseas students. Scholarship is available for postgraduate research
students (PhD or Masters by Research) to undertake a course of study lasting
between two months and one year at a centre of advanced study
preferably, although not necessarily, outwith Scotland. An individual
scholarship will last for up to a maximum of one year from the date of the
award (normally from the June of the award year) or from another date chosen by
the Selection Panel. The application deadline is 12 May 2014.

Eligibility:
-Scholarship is open to all Home/EU/Overseas
postgraduate research students (PhD or Masters by Research) currently
registered at the Universities of Glasgow and/or Strathclyde.
-Available to research students from any academic discipline.
-Open to high quality students who have (in the opinion of the Selection Panel)
already shown academic distinction and promise during the term of their
research studies.
-Collaborative research between Glasgow and Strathclyde is advantageous but not
essential.
-Students would not normally be awarded the Scholarship within six months of
starting or within six months of submitting their PhD.

What does it cover? The Scholarship award will consist of travel costs plus subsistence up
to a maximum level of £60 per day, including accommodation costs. This level is
based on subsistence allowances for University of Glasgow employees abroad. The
number and value of the awards allocated each year will be at the discretion of
the Panel. Individual Scholarships are unlikely to exceed £4,000.
Selection Criteria: The prestigious Mac Robertson Scholarship is hotly contested and a
high number of applications are received each year. The following will be taken
into account when assessing applications:
-Eligibility – the scholar must comply with all eligibility criteria.
-The research to be undertaken should be additional to and not essential to the
completion of the applicant’s research degree.
-Evidence of collaboration between Strathclyde and Glasgow in the research
being carried out would be advantageous.
-Evidence of an innovative proposal and/or initiative taken by the student to
build relationships with international experts or forge links with world class
facilities.
-Evidence that the proposed project/travel would benefit the applicant’s
School/Research Institute.
-Clear evidence of communication with the host institution (e.g. welcome
letter/letter of endorsement).
